Transaction fb677f331b8ef070667c5a1bc92569b5ed9a85bfc2b8345551957e729bf482b0
1 Input
1 Output
-
fb677f331b8ef070667c5a1bc92569b5ed9a85bfc2b8345551957e729bf482b0:0
- value
- 651525165
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ecd3197d5689fcde5aaa466c3897de60dbab672b
- address
- bc1qanf3jl2k387duk42gekr3977vrd6keetrjp03s